Crypto.BlowfishEncrypt

Crypto.BlowfishEncrypt ( string Source,
string Destination,
string Key )
Примеры

Описание

Создает зашифрованную в blowfish копию файла.

Параметры

Source

(строка) Полный путь к файлу, который надо зашифровать.

Destination

(строка) Полный путь и имя, для зашифрованного в blowfish, файла.

Key

(строка) Секретный ключ, которым были зашифрованы данные.

Возврат

Ничего. Можно использовать Application.GetLastError для определения случился ли отказ в работе этого действия и почему.
Смотрите также: Связанные действия

Примеры

Пример 1

-- Create a blowfish-encrypted copy of a text file in the user's temp folder
-- Создаем, кодированную в blowfish, копию текстового файла в папке пользователя temp
Crypto.BlowfishEncrypt(_TempFolder .. "\\myfile.txt", _TempFolder .. "\\myfile_blowfished.txt", "trustno1withthispassword");

-- Check if any errors occurred from calling the Crypto.BlowfishEncrypt action.
-- If an error occurred, display it's error message in a dialog message.
-- Смотрим, не было ли ошибки при вызове действия Crypto.BlowfishEncrypt.
-- Если произошла ошибка, показываем сообщение об ошибке в диалоговом окне сообщения.
error = Application.GetLastError();
if (error ~= 0) then
    Dialog.Message("Error", _tblErrorMessages[error], MB_OK, MB_ICONEXCLAMATION, MB_DEFBUTTON1);
end

-- Open the encrypted file to see its contents.
-- Открываем кодированный файл для просмотра его содержимого.
File.Open(_TempFolder .. "\\myfile_blowfished.txt");
Создает копию файла, кодированную в blowfish, размещенную в папке пользователя temp, затем открывает этот файл в текстовом редакторе пользователя по умолчанию.
Смотрите также: Связанные действия